Overview

CORU wish to engage the services of a supplier to provide procurement and project delivery contract support services to the CORU Executive to support the procurement and implementation of a Registrant Management System. This expected timeline (from award of contract to delivery of Registrant Management System) is expected to take 24 months to complete, starting in Q2 2026. The scope of the required procurement support services include: 1. Availability to CORU on a regularly scheduled basis of up to 112.5 hours a month to a maximum of 1,125 hours (150 days) per year, which will include attendance in CORU’s offices as required. 2. Identify potential suppliers and undertake preliminary market engagement, including a comparative analysis of registration system solutions in use by similar regulatory bodies in Ireland and the UK. Prepare a report and a recommendation to senior management on the preferred solution type. 3. Develop the technical specification for the Registrant Management System which will require developing a strong understanding of the current system functionality and CORU processes, and engagement with the CORU executive in relation to further system requirements not available in the current system. Develop all procurement documentations and manage procurement process including; a. Publication on eTenders platform b. Responding to queries from prospective tenderers c. Managing evaluation process, notifying preferred tenders and issuing of contracts. 4. Project managing the development and implementation of registrant system to include; a. Increasing levels of autonomy, influence, and responsibility as the project progresses, becoming the primary subject matter expert for the project. The post-holder will be required to build and retain in-depth knowledge and provide ongoing leadership across the project. Increased responsibility will require greater attendance at governance and Council meetings alongside expanded ownership of deliverables, decision-making and stakeholder engagement. b. Ensuring Registration Management System is delivered successfully – in accordance with agreed milestones, timelines and budget specifications. c. Producing and maintaining delivery artefacts (e.g. RAID logs, project plans, risk registers, issue logs, change requests). d. Planning and delivering data migration activities, including data mapping, cleansing, validation, reconciliation, and cutover planning. e. Defining migration strategies, success criteria, and rollback approaches. f. Translating business, regulatory and user needs into clear technical or functional requirements. g. Interpreting complex technical information and communicate it clearly to non-technical stakeholders. h. Acting as a trusted subject matter expert, advising stakeholders and supporting decision-making. i. Building relationships with CORU executive and successful tenderer project team. j. Leading and facilitating meetings, workshops, and decision- making forums. Providing updates to CORU SMT, ICT Steering Committee and Council as required k. Providing clear recommendations to senior stakeholders.
